What is crop insurance?

Crop insurance is a special form of coverage designed to protect your agricultural business following a loss caused by natural disasters or declines in market prices. The policy can offset the costs associated with things like:

  • Revenue losses due to market volatility and price fluctuations
  • Physical damage to crops from hail, drought, floods, and frost
  • Costs associated with replanting or prevented planting scenarios

What Does It Cover

What does crop insurance cover in Polo, Illinois?

Like other forms of commercial protection, coverage will extend to:

  • Yield protection
  • Revenue protection
  • Hail and wind damage
  • Prevented planting
  • And specialty crop endorsements.

However, a crop insurance policy may have differences in definitions, limit options, and eligibility in comparison to your standard farm or property insurance policy.
